Body
Authorship and Creation
Madame X's producer is recorded as Henry Wilson Savage[10]. Its director is recorded as George F. Marion[4]. Cast members include Dorothy Donnelly[7], John Bowers[8], and Ralph Morgan[9].
Publication
Madame X's publication date is recorded as +1916-01-01T00:00:00Z[14]. Genres include drama film[5] and silent film[6].
